作为一名网络工程师,我经常遇到用户反馈“VPN不能连国外”的问题,这个问题看似简单,实则涉及网络架构、协议配置、防火墙策略甚至本地ISP(互联网服务提供商)的限制等多个层面,今天我们就来深入剖析这一现象的常见成因,并提供实用的解决方法。
我们要明确“不能连国外”具体指什么:是连接失败、速度极慢、还是能连接但无法访问特定网站?这将直接影响排查方向,如果只是访问某个国外网站(如Google、YouTube)失败,而其他网站正常,可能是目标网站被屏蔽或DNS污染;如果是所有国外IP都无法建立连接,则更可能出在隧道协议或网络路径上。
最常见的原因之一是协议不兼容或被封禁,许多国家对加密隧道协议(如OpenVPN、IKEv2、WireGuard)进行深度包检测(DPI),一旦识别为“非法通信”,就会主动阻断,此时即便你使用的是合法的VPN服务商,也可能因协议特征被识别而无法连接,解决办法包括更换协议(如从OpenVPN切换到WireGuard)、启用“混淆模式”(obfsproxy)或使用基于HTTP/HTTPS的代理协议(如Shadowsocks、V2Ray)。
第二个常见原因是本地网络限制,某些企业、学校或公共Wi-Fi会设置严格的出口规则,禁止访问境外IP地址,即使你的设备本身没有问题,也无法绕过这些限制,此时可尝试使用移动热点(换一个ISP)或联系网络管理员申请权限。
第三个关键点是DNS解析异常,如果你的DNS服务器在国内,它可能无法正确解析国外域名,导致连接超时或错误,建议手动更换为可靠的公共DNS(如Cloudflare的1.1.1.1或Google的8.8.8.8),并在VPN客户端中开启“DNS泄漏保护”功能。
还需检查防火墙或杀毒软件拦截,部分安全软件会误判VPN流量为威胁,自动阻止其运行,可以临时关闭防火墙测试,若恢复正常,则需将相关进程加入白名单。
也是最容易被忽略的一点:时间同步问题,很多现代加密协议(如TLS、IPSec)依赖精确的时间戳进行握手验证,如果系统时间偏差超过5秒,连接就会失败,请确保设备时间与NTP服务器同步。
解决“VPN不能连国外”的问题需要分步排查:先确认是否为协议或DNS问题,再检查本地网络环境,最后排除安全软件干扰,建议用户优先尝试更换协议和DNS,这是最快速有效的初步方案,如果以上方法均无效,可能需要联系专业技术人员协助分析日志或调整网络策略。
作为网络工程师,我们不仅要解决问题,更要理解问题背后的技术逻辑——这才是提升网络素养的核心所在。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速









